2    Job Scope 
Main Target Summary    Providing daily operational support on FAP & MIS reports.
Tasks Summary & Responsibilities (please enclose organizational charts on last page)
    Process freight invoices for payment. Investigating and resolving freight invoices that are on hold for review. 
    Ensure transportation carriers are paid within established payment terms.
    Audit rates and freight invoices for accuracy.  Ensure systems are updated with missing and incorrect information. 
    Interface with transportation providers and TE Transportation Associates to resolve invoice discrepancies and communicate payment details.
    Run and distribute reports as required. Need to be MIS report savvy with understanding of all latest tools.
    Support all financial audit request related to internal and external audit of freight payments. 
    Ensure to monitor & work on open accruals & thereby ensuring aging between accruals vs invoice postings is kept to 30days or less.
    Drive, monitor & track the hard copies against the transaction entries in SAP with an objective to ensure on-time payment.
    Involve in VAS handling validation & be primary face of contact for carriers. Proactively drive & address all open issues/queries in an organized manner.
    Initiate & drive process improvements by standardizing & defining the process.
    Work in testing and give feedback.
    Support on Project related queries & be backup to project team member.
